@media (min-width:320px) and (max-width:767px){
    .navbar{       
        height: auto;
    }
    .navbar-brand {
        max-width: 200px;
    }
    .banner-content{
        display: block;
    }
    .green-box{
        margin-bottom: 15px;
    }
    .banner-btn-grp{
        display: block;
        width: auto;
        margin-top: 20px;
    }
    .main-banner{
        margin-top: 70px;
    }
    .main-banner .display-4{
        width: auto;
        font-size: 34px;
    }
    .banner-btn-grp .btn-primary{
        margin-right: 0;
    }
    .btn-lg{
        width: 100%;
        padding: 15px;
        font-size: 18px;
        margin-bottom: 15px;
    }
    .navbar-nav{
        align-items: flex-start;
        padding: 15px 0;
    }
    .btn-sm{
        padding: 10px;
    }
    .navbar-nav li{
        padding: 5px 0;
    }
    h2{
        font-size: 25px;
    }
    .main{
        padding: 25px 0;
    }
    ul.ex-rate{
        width: 100%;
        margin-top: 10px;
    }
    ul.ex-rate li{
        padding: 10px 0;
        font-size: 16px;
    }
    footer{
        padding: 25px 0;
    }
    footer ul li{
        display: block;
        padding: 10px 0;
    }
    .btn-info img{
        max-width: 50px;
    }
    .chat-area{
        bottom: 16px;
    }
    footer p{
        font-size: 12px;
    }
    footer ul li a{
        font-size: 14px;
    }
    /* Sign in page */
    .sign-in-area{
        height: calc(100vh - 66px);
        padding-top: 58px;
    }
    .signin-box .form-control{
        height: 35px;
    }
    .show-hide{
        top: 35px;
    }
    .show-hide a{
        font-size: 12px;
    }
    .signin-box{
        width: auto;
    }
    .signin-title{
        font-size: 20px;
        margin-bottom: 10px;
    }
    .signin-box label{
        font-size: 12px;
    }
    .rem-forgot a{
        font-size: 12px;
    }
    a.signup-link{
        font-size: 12px;
    }

    /* Sign up page */
    .signup-box{
        width: auto;
    }
    .sign-up-area{
        padding-top: 90px;
    }
    .signup-title {
        font-size: 20px;
        margin-bottom: 10px;
    }
    .signup-box label {
        font-size: 12px;
    }
    .signup-box .form-control {
        height: 35px;
    }
   span.exist-accnt{
        display: block;
    }
    .signup-box-link{
        flex-direction: column;
        align-items: flex-start;
    }
    
    .signup-box-link .btn{
        margin-bottom: 15px;
    }
    .signup-box-link .signin-link{
        font-size: 16px;
        text-transform: uppercase;
    }
     /* 20-June-2020 */
    label{
        font-size: 14px;
    }
    .become-agent{
        padding-top: 90px;
    }
    h4{
        font-size: 18px;
    }
    h5{
        font-size: 16px;
    }

    .contact-box, .profile-box{
        width: 100%;
    }
    .contact-title, .profile-title{
        font-size: 28px;
    }
    .profile-area, .sign-up-area, .rec-area{
        padding-top: 120px;
        min-height: auto;
    }
    .sign-in-area{
        min-height: auto;
        padding-top: 0;
    }
    .verification-code{
        width: 100%;
    }
    .send-money-wrapper{
        padding-top: 90px;
    }
    .steps-holder ul li{
        font-size: 12px;
    }
    .step{
        width: 40px;
        height: 40px;
        border-width: 2px;
    }
    .step.active{
        border-width: 2px;
    }
    .steps-holder ul::before{
        height: 2px;
    }
    .send-money-main .form-control,  .agent-form-info-box .form-control{
        height: 35px;
    }
    .currency-name{
        top: 40px;
    }
    .custome-box-btn-grp{
        flex-direction: column;
    }
    .custom-box-btn{
        margin-bottom: 20px;
    }
    .track-box .btn{
        margin-top: 0;
        margin-bottom: 25px;
    }
    .track-box-status{
        margin-bottom: 20px;
    }
    .custom-box-btn{
        margin-right: 0;
    }
    .to{
    top: 76px;
    
    }
}

@media (min-width:768px) and (max-width:991px){
    .navbar{       
        height: auto;
    }
    .main-banner{
        margin-top: 70px;
        height: calc(100vh - 600px);
    }
    .main-banner .display-4{
        width: 50%;
        font-size: 34px;
    }
    .banner-btn-grp .btn-lg{
        font-size: 15px;
        padding: 15px;
    }
    .navbar-nav{
        align-items: flex-start;
        padding: 15px 0;
    }
    .btn-sm{
        padding: 10px;
    }
    .navbar-nav li{
        padding: 5px 0;
    }
    h2{
        font-size: 25px;
    }
    .main{
        padding: 25px 0;
    }
    ul.ex-rate{
        width: 100%;
        margin-top: 10px;
    }
    ul.ex-rate li{
        padding: 10px 0;
        font-size: 16px;
    }
    footer{
        padding: 25px 0;
    }
    footer ul li{
        display: block;
        padding: 10px 0;
    }
    .btn-info img{
        max-width: 50px;
    }
    .chat-area{
        bottom: 16px;
    }
    footer p{
        font-size: 12px;
    }
    footer ul li a{
        font-size: 14px;
    }
    /* Sign in page */
    .sign-in-area{
        height: calc(100vh - 500px);
        padding-top: 58px;
    }
    .signin-box .form-control, .agent-form-info-box .form-control{
        height: 35px;
    }
    .show-hide{
        top: 35px;
    }
    .show-hide a{
        font-size: 12px;
    }
   
    .signin-title{
        font-size: 20px;
        margin-bottom: 10px;
    }
    .signin-box label{
        font-size: 12px;
    }
    .rem-forgot a{
        font-size: 12px;
    }
    a.signup-link{
        font-size: 12px;
    }
    /* Signup */
    .signup-box{
        width: auto;
    }
    
    .signup-title{
        font-size: 20px;
        margin-bottom: 10px;
    }
    .signup-box label{
        font-size: 12px;
    }
    /* 20-June-2020 */
    label{
        font-size: 12px;
    }
    .become-agent{
        padding-top: 90px;
    }
    h4{
        font-size: 20px;
    }
  
    .contact-title, .profile-title{
        font-size: 30px;
    }

    .profile-area, .sign-up-area, .rec-area{
        padding-top: 120px;
        min-height: auto;
    }
    .verification-code{
        width: 50%;
    }
    .custom-box-btn{
        margin-right: 16px;
    }
    .to{
        top: 76px;
        
        }
}

@media (min-width:992px) and (max-width:1199px){
    .main-banner{
        margin-top: 70px;
        height: calc(100vh - 200px);
    }
    .main-banner .display-4{
        width: auto;
        font-size: 34px;
    }
    .btn-lg{        
        padding: 15px;
        font-size: 18px;
        margin-bottom: 15px;
    }
    .btn-sm{
        padding: 10px;
    }    
    h2{
        font-size: 25px;
    }
    .main{
        padding: 25px 0;
    }
    ul.ex-rate{
        width: 70%;
        margin-top: 10px;
    }
    ul.ex-rate li{       
        font-size: 16px;
    }
    footer ul li{
        padding: 0 10px;
    }
    .btn-info img{
        max-width: 50px;
    }
    .chat-area{
        bottom: 16px;
    }
   /* Sign in page */
   .sign-in-area{
    height: calc(100vh - 180px);
    padding-top: 58px;
}
.signin-box .form-control{
    height: 35px;
}
.show-hide{
    top: 35px;
}
.show-hide a{
    font-size: 12px;
}

.signin-title{
    font-size: 20px;
    margin-bottom: 10px;
}
.signin-box label{
    font-size: 12px;
}
.rem-forgot a{
    font-size: 12px;
}
a.signup-link{
    font-size: 12px;
}
 /* Signup */
 .signup-box{
    width: auto;
}

.signup-title{
    font-size: 20px;
    margin-bottom: 10px;
}
.signup-box label{
    font-size: 12px;
}
 /* 20-June-2020 */
 label{
    font-size: 12px;
}
.become-agent{
    padding-top: 90px;
}
h4{
    font-size: 20px;
}
.sign-up-area{
    padding-top: 90px;
}
.contact-title, .profile-title{
    font-size: 30px;
}
}

@media (min-width:1200px) and (max-width:1600px){
    .main-banner{
        margin-top: 70px;
        height: calc(100vh - 200px);
    }
    .main-banner .display-4{
        width: 40%;
        font-size: 34px;
    }
    .btn-lg{        
        padding: 15px;
        font-size: 18px;
    }
    .btn-sm{
        padding: 10px;
    }    
    h2{
        font-size: 25px;
    }
    .main{
        padding: 45px 0;
    }
    ul.ex-rate{
        width: 70%;
        margin-top: 10px;
    }
    ul.ex-rate li{       
        font-size: 16px;
    }
    footer ul li{
        padding: 0 10px;
    }
    .btn-info img{
        max-width: 50px;
    }
    .chat-area{
        bottom: 16px;
    }
       /* Sign in page */
   .sign-in-area{
    height: calc(100vh - 156px);
    padding-top: 58px;
}
.signin-box .form-control{
    height: 45px;
}
.show-hide{
    top: 41px;
}
.show-hide a{
    font-size: 14px;
}

.signin-title{
    font-size: 28px;
    margin-bottom: 10px;
}
.signin-box label{
    font-size: 14px;
}
.rem-forgot a{
    font-size: 14px;
}
a.signup-link{
    font-size: 14px;
}
 /* 20-June-2020 */
 label{
    font-size: 14px;
}
.become-agent{
    padding-top: 90px;
}
h4{
    font-size: 20px;
}
.sign-up-area{
    padding-top: 120px;
}
.contact-title, .profile-title{
    font-size: 30px;
}
}